Discovering the secret corners of Palma


Of all the places to discover on the island, the Serra de Tramuntana marks a place that continuously enthralls. A unique place of immeasurable beauty in which can be found such beautiful towns as Valldemossa, Sóller, Fornalutx, Biniaraix, Esporles or Deià. The best idea for the winter months is to discover these secret paths taking one of the excellent hiking routes that are highly recommended in Mallorca.


Climb to Alaró Castle


Although it can be tiring at some points, the climb to Castillo de Alaró is another one of those plans made in Mallorca that always feel good in the winter months. With the promise of enjoying a good homemade dish once you arrive at the castle, the tour is highly recommended for all those who have a camera permanently around their neck since the panoramas that this point of interest gives you are wonderful.


A walk through Sóller (the train, port and so on)


Few things are as charming as covering the journey from Palma to Sóller in his legendary wooden train; the train that crosses the heart of the island and goes through the leafiest Tramuntana. In addition to being able to enjoy the island’s unspoiled nature, this route gives you unique moments. The most outstanding of which is he crossing through the Valley of Sóller, a point where you can see hundreds of orange fields ... The area’s star.


The magic of local markets


Sóller, Santa María, Sineu or Pollença are some examples of those local markets in which the traditions and authenticity that has made Mallorca a world tourist destination are maintained. The best way to enjoy them is carrying a Mallorcan basket and first thing in the morning.

La isla de Mallorca esconde rincones espectaculares para disfrutar en familia, con la pareja o con amigos. Al numero de hoteles disponibles y especializados se une el gran abanico de servicios existentes, y que complementan un destino ya de por si magnifico.

En el norte de la isla, se encuentra el municipio de Muro, con una playa, Playa de Muro, que transcurre por 5,5kms de fina arena blanca, declarada la playa mas segura de Europa en 1999. Este destino es ideal para familias y no es difícil encontrar un hotel para familias en Playa de Muro. El Parque Natural de s'Albufera se encuentra también en Muro, y fue el primer parque natural de las Islas Baleares, inaugurado en 1988. A día de hoy es uno de los grandes atractivos para aquellos que disfrutan del ejercicio (senderismo, nordic walking, ciclismo) al aire libre en un entorno incomparable.


Otro destino popular en el norte de la isla de Mallorca es Acudía, a 50 kilómetros de la capital Palma de Mallorca, y que cuenta con un puerto propio. Acudía se caracteriza por un ambiente mas familiar, con servicios de calidad en una zona excepcionalmente bonita. Cuenta con mas de 14 playas o calas para disfrutar del mar mediterráneo, 1 campo de golf, puerto deportivo para la practica de toda clase de deportes náuticos, rutas cicloturisticas que conectan con otros municipios de la isla...es decir, una infinidad de posibilidades al alcance de su mano.
